The Town of Greenburgh in central Westchester includes the villages of Tarrytown, Dobbs Ferry, Hastings-on-Hudson, Irvington, Ardsley, and Elmsford plus unincorporated areas like Hartsdale.

Good to know in Greenburgh

  • Its Hudson River villages are known as the Rivertowns
  • Metro-North's Hudson and Harlem lines serve opposite sides of the town
  • The Mario M. Cuomo Bridge lands at Tarrytown, linking Westchester to Rockland County

Permits & licensing

Contractor licensing runs through the county consumer-protection office, while building permits are issued by individual town, city, and village building departments.
